summ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Jens Georg <mail@jensge.org>2014-07-25 20:41:36 +0200
committerJens Georg <mail@jensge.org>2014-07-25 20:42:43 +0200
commit3cdbb183ebaaa6ad71477fceb87b2778e498c542 (patch)
tree54a81c66c1ed85a60f6df77d2450b8f3f2ea6cd2
parent1c737f1aa27c539b4975b0bb09125d65dbe9ed78 (diff)
downloadgssdp-3cdbb183ebaaa6ad71477fceb87b2778e498c542.tar.gz
Check arguments in PktInfoMessage public functions
Signed-off-by: Jens Georg <mail@jensge.org>
-rw-r--r--libgssdp/gssdp-pktinfo-message.c4
1 files changed, 4 insertions, 0 deletions
diff --git a/libgssdp/gssdp-pktinfo-message.c b/libgssdp/gssdp-pktinfo-message.c
index 56acd92..ed0fe40 100644
--- a/libgssdp/gssdp-pktinfo-message.c
+++ b/libgssdp/gssdp-pktinfo-message.c
@@ -234,11 +234,15 @@ gssdp_pktinfo_message_get_ifindex (GSSDPPktinfoMessage *message)
GInetAddress *
gssdp_pktinfo_message_get_local_addr (GSSDPPktinfoMessage *message)
{
+ g_return_val_if_fail (GSSDP_IS_PKTINFO_MESSAGE (message), NULL);
+
return message->priv->iface_addr;
}
GInetAddress *
gssdp_pktinfo_message_get_pkt_addr (GSSDPPktinfoMessage *message)
{
+ g_return_val_if_fail (GSSDP_IS_PKTINFO_MESSAGE (message), NULL);
+
return message->priv->pkt_addr;
}